Transaction 333600572dda329603a2b56e67267e9dcb3d7b3b28ef74a68d2351d3a3921824
1 Input
1 Output
-
333600572dda329603a2b56e67267e9dcb3d7b3b28ef74a68d2351d3a3921824:0
- value
- 106360
- script pubkey
- OP_0 OP_PUSHBYTES_20 4784e68fec0c68aeb4a7fc26548ed94087b881b8
- address
- ltc1qg7zwdrlvp352ad98lsn9frkegzrm3qdc475lqd